When discussing a criminal record on an application, transparency is key. Briefly mention the conviction without extensive details, then emphasize the lessons learned and personal growth since the offense. When writing a letter explaining a felony conviction, be clear and concise. Start by stating your conviction and its details. It is also important to express remorse and outline any steps taken toward rehabilitation. Providing this context can be crucial when dealing with US legal documents with a criminal record.
